Germination Stage

Duration of Germination ๐ŸŒฑ

The germination period for Hydrangea 'Little Lime' typically spans 2 to 4 weeks. For optimal results, maintain a temperature range of 65ยฐF to 75ยฐF (18ยฐC to 24ยฐC) to encourage sprouting.

Conditions for Successful Germination ๐ŸŒฟ

To ensure successful germination, start with a well-draining seed starting mix. This is crucial for preventing waterlogging, which can hinder growth.

Light Exposure ๐Ÿ’ก

Provide indirect sunlight or use fluorescent light to promote healthy seedling development. Too much direct sunlight can be detrimental at this stage.

Moisture Levels ๐Ÿ’ง

Keep moisture levels consistent, ensuring the soil remains damp but not soggy. This balance is key to nurturing your seeds without drowning them.

Seedling Stage

Duration of Seedling Growth ๐ŸŒฑ

The seedling stage of Hydrangea 'Little Lime' lasts about 4 to 6 weeks. During this time, the plants develop their true leaves, marking a significant step in their growth journey.

Characteristics of Seedlings ๐ŸŒฟ

In the early stages, seedlings showcase cotyledons, which are the first leaves that appear. Following these, true leaves emerge, indicating healthy development.

Size and Height

Typically, seedlings grow to a height of 2 to 4 inches. This compact size is perfect for nurturing in a controlled environment.

Color Indicators

Bright green foliage is a telltale sign of healthy seedlings. This vibrant color not only looks appealing but also suggests that the plants are thriving.

Vegetative Growth Stage

Duration of Vegetative Growth ๐ŸŒฑ

The vegetative growth stage of the Hydrangea 'Little Lime' typically lasts between 1 to 2 years. This duration can vary based on environmental conditions, such as temperature and sunlight.

Changes in Foliage and Structure ๐Ÿƒ

During this stage, you'll notice significant changes in the plant's foliage. Larger, serrated leaves begin to emerge, giving the plant a fuller appearance.

As the plant matures, it can grow to heights of 3 to 5 feet and widths of 3 to 4 feet. This expansion is accompanied by increased branching, resulting in a bushier look that enhances its visual appeal.

The lush green foliage not only adds beauty to your garden but also indicates the plant's health and vitality. This stage is crucial for establishing a strong foundation for future flowering.

Flowering Stage

Duration of Flowering ๐ŸŒผ

The flowering stage of the Hydrangea 'Little Lime' typically occurs from late summer to early fall, lasting about 6 to 8 weeks. This period is crucial for showcasing the plant's vibrant blooms.

Color Changes and Bloom Characteristics ๐ŸŽจ

Initially, the flowers emerge in a striking lime-green hue. As they mature, these blooms transition to a lovely white and eventually take on a soft pink shade.

Flower Structure ๐ŸŒธ

The flowers form cone-shaped clusters that not only add beauty to your garden but also attract pollinators. This characteristic makes them a favorite among gardeners looking to support local wildlife.

Growth Rate and Maturation

How Long Until Fully Grown? ๐ŸŒฑ

Hydrangea 'Little Lime' typically reaches its full size within 2-3 years. This relatively quick maturation makes it a favorite among gardeners looking for fast results.

Factors Affecting Growth Rate ๐ŸŒฟ

Several factors can influence how quickly your hydrangea grows:

  • Soil Quality: Nutrient-rich, well-draining soil is essential for promoting faster growth. Poor soil can stunt development.
  • Sunlight Exposure: These plants thrive in full sun to partial shade, which can significantly enhance their growth rate.
  • Watering Practices: Maintaining consistent moisture without overwatering is crucial. Too much water can lead to root rot, while too little can stress the plant.

Average Growth Rate Per Year ๐Ÿ“

Under optimal conditions, you can expect your Hydrangea 'Little Lime' to grow approximately 1-2 feet per year. This steady growth allows for a lush, full appearance in a relatively short time.

Notable Changes Throughout Lifecycle

Changes in Plant Size and Structure ๐ŸŒฑ

In the early stages, Hydrangea 'Little Lime' exhibits a compact growth form, remaining small and unassuming. As it transitions into the vegetative growth stage, expect a significant increase in size, with the plant stretching out and becoming bushier.

Seasonal Changes in Appearance ๐ŸŒธ

Spring brings a burst of new growth, showcasing vibrant green foliage that signals the plant's awakening. As summer rolls in, flowering begins, revealing stunning color transitions that captivate the eye.

Transition from Vegetative to Reproductive Stages ๐ŸŒผ

As the plant matures, you'll notice indicators of transition, such as flower buds forming. Seasonal cues, including temperature and light changes, play a crucial role in triggering this flowering phase, marking a beautiful evolution in the plant's lifecycle.
